Long-stay visas (Type D)

Luxembourg Investor Residence Permit

A residence permit for third-country nationals making a substantial qualifying investment in the Luxembourg economy.

Issuing authority
General Department of Immigration (with prior approval from the Minister of the Economy or Finance)
Existing / new business
Minimum EUR 500,000
New business must create at least 5 jobs within 3 years; figures from the official investor page - verify before relying on them
Management / investment structure
Minimum EUR 3 million
As stated on the official page
Financial deposit
Minimum EUR 20 million held for 5 years
As stated on the official page
Excluded
Real-estate investment does not qualify
Validity
Maximum 3 years, renewable

Who it's for

Non-EU nationals able to make and maintain a substantial qualifying investment in the Luxembourg economy under one of the defined categories.

Requirements

  • Valid passport
  • A qualifying investment under one of the defined categories (business, management structure or deposit)
  • Ministerial approval of the investment (Economy or Finance) before the residence application
  • Commitment to maintain the investment (and, for a new business, create jobs) for the required period
  • Temporary authorisation to stay granted before entry

What you can do

  • Reside in Luxembourg on the basis of the qualifying investment
  • Choose among the investment categories (existing/new business, management structure, or financial deposit)
  • Renew the permit while maintaining the investment
  • Apply for family reunification once resident

How to apply

Obtain ministerial approval of the intended investment from the relevant minister (Economy for business investments; Finance for management structures and deposits).

Submit the temporary authorisation to stay application to the General Department of Immigration from your country of origin, and obtain a Type D visa if required.

After arrival, file the declaration of arrival within 3 days, complete the medical examination, and apply for the residence permit within 3 months.

Documents

  • Full copy of valid passport
  • Evidence of the qualifying investment and ministerial approval
  • Criminal record extract or affidavit
  • Proof of suitable housing
  • Declaration of arrival copy
  • EUR 80 fee payment
